Tips on Finding Affordable Quality Boots

First, shop around. Take the time to compare prices at different stores and online retailers. You may be surprised by how much prices can vary between stores, so take the time to do your research. You can also look for special promotions or discounts that may be available.

Next, consider buying used or refurbished boots. There are many reputable businesses that offer pre-owned boots at discounted prices. Just make sure to check the condition of the boots before buying them in order to ensure they are still in good shape.

Third, think about buying basic designs rather than trendy styles. The more classic and minimalistic the design of the boot, the more likely it is to stay in style for longer periods of time. This will save you money in the long run since your boots will last longer before needing to be replaced with something more on trend.

Finally, check out outlet stores or factory shops for discounted items from past seasons’ collections. These items may still be quite fashionable but have just been marked down due to their age. They tend to go quickly though so keep an eye out for them if you’re interested in finding a bargain!

5 Best Hiking Boots You Can Buy Right Now

  • Salomon X Ultra 3 Mid GTX: This lightweight mid-cut boot is designed to provide ample cushioning and support during long hikes. It offers superior waterproof protection with its Gore-Tex lining, as well as excellent traction thanks to its grippy Contagrip outsole.
  • Vasque St. Elias GTX: This burly full-grain leather boot offers excellent ankle support and durability for off-trail treks. It features a Vibram outsole for maximum grip and stability, as well as a waterproof Gore-Tex membrane to keep your feet dry in wet conditions.
  • Merrell Moab 2 Waterproof: If you prefer lighter weight footwear while still wanting plenty of support, then this popular option is just what you need! The Moab 2 has plenty of cushioning thanks to its air cushioned midsole, along with a durable Vibram sole that provides great traction on any surface.
  • Keen Targhee III Waterproof: With an aggressive lug pattern on the sole, this low cut boot gives you great traction when tackling tough terrain or slippery trails – all while offering breathable comfort thanks to its mesh upper construction and moisture wicking footbed liner.
  • Columbia Newton Ridge Plus II Waterproof: A stylish yet practical option that won't break the bank - the Newton Ridge Plus II from Columbia offers good cushioning from heel to toe so you can take those extra steps without feeling too much fatigue after long hikes or treks through rough terrain.
